Dacia showed a special preview of the Extreme trim level of the Spring model at the European Motor Show in Brussels. The Extreme equipment level, which is in line with the outdoor spirit and makes a difference with its original appearance, is starting to be offered to users in Jogger and Duster along with Spring.

Dacia Spring introduces the all-new ELECTRIC 65 engine (65hp / 48kW) with the Extreme trim. This engine is only offered with Spring Extreme. The new engine increases the torque transferred to the wheels through a unique transmission, providing a longer range, more acceleration and recovery.

Thanks to the new ELECTRIC 65 engine, Spring Extreme offers a range of 220 km in the WLTP mixed cycle.

INCREASED HANDLING CONTROL: A SOLUTION THAT WORKS MIRACLES OUTSIDE ASPHALT

Navigating muddy, snowy or slippery surfaces can be challenging with two-wheel drive. Dacia’s intelligent Enhanced Grip Control solution supports drivers in dealing with challenging conditions and offers greater freedom of movement.

Increased Grip Control is offered as standard on the Jogger’s Extreme trim level. It is activated by a button on the center console. It regulates the Electronic Stability Control (ESC) settings, allowing the wheels to turn more freely and hold better on loose/difficult surfaces.

Dacia’s iconic outdoor vehicle, Duster, is offered with a four-wheel drive option and continues to be one of the most reliable SUVs on the market.

PART OF THE INNATURE ACCESSORY SERIES – SLEEP PACK

The Sleep Pack is available for the first time as part of the InNature accessory range. Available on all Jogger trim levels, the Sleep Pack makes it possible to convert the passenger compartment into a bedroom in just a few minutes. This removable accessory is compatible with all Jogger vehicles.

Weighing less than 50 kilograms in total, the package includes a double bed, a shelf and a storage area that can be set up in less than two minutes without assistance.

This practical wooden accessory aims to complement the camping equipment that many users already own (such as a cooler or portable stove).

Optimized cargo capacity, a discreet Sleeping Pack and generous dimensions

When the trunk lid is closed, the package is hidden and the Jogger looks like a normal 5-passenger vehicle. Thanks to cleverly applied engineering, it always provides storage space (220 liters) even when the package is installed. It can also be used as a shelf when the logo cover is closed.

The sliding bed system in the rear doors includes a mattress measuring 190 cm x 130 cm. This installation provides at least 60 cm wide headroom.

There are also accessories that complement Dacia’s InNature Sleeping Package:

  • Sunshades on all windows for light and privacy control
  • Smart tent that can be connected to the Jogger and provide extra sleeping space when the trunk is open

Sleep Pack will be offered to users on demand in Turkey starting from June.
